Canada vs. Belgium livestream options for 2022 World Cup

Canada will face Belgium in a FIFA World Cup group stage clash at the Ahmad bin Ali Stadium.

Kickoff time for Canada vs. Belgium Group F match will be at 2 p.m. ET on November 23.

Both the Red Devils (and the Canadians) will be looking to get their campaign off the ground at the Al Rayyan venue of 44,000 seats.

What are the other Group F games when you want them?

Teams will want to earn enough points in each of their three group stage games to guarantee a place in the knockout rounds.

The winner of the Group F competition will face the winners of the Group E final, while the second-placed team will face its losers.

Group E includes Japan, Costa Rica and Germany.

  • Wednesday, Nov. 23: Morocco vs. Croatia
  • Wednesday, Nov. 23: Belgium vs. Canada
  • Sunday, November 27: Belgium vs. Morocco
  • Sunday, Nov. 27: Croatia vs. Canada
  • Thursday, Dec. 1: Canada vs. Morocco
  • Thursday, Dec. 1: Croatia vs. Belgium
